Pelican, Alaska, located within Hoonah-Angoon Census Area, is a small coastal community with a population of about 90 residents. The town's remote geography is characterized by its rugged coastline and proximity to the Scenic Inside Passage, which can present unique challenges for mail delivery. The limited infrastructure, with few roads connecting to the outside world, means that deliveries often rely on marine transport during favorable weather conditions. Given its small population and isolated location, USPS delivery schedules can be affected by the frequency of ferry services and the weather patterns prevalent in Alaska.
The weather in Pelican can be quite variable, with long, cold winters and mild summers. Rain and storms, particularly during the fall and winter months, can disrupt transportation schedules and delay shipments. Consequently, residents may experience longer wait times for mail and packages, especially during adverse weather conditions. Despite these challenges, USPS strives to provide reliable service to Pelican, utilizing both planes and boats to ensure that the community remains connected with the rest of the state and beyond.
